The Verdict: Which is Better?
When placing Organic fruit & grain bars and Semi-Sweet Chocolate Chips side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.
For calorie-conscious consumers, Organic fruit & grain bars is the clear winner. With 222 fewer calories per 100g than its competitor, it allows for more volume while keeping your energy intake in check.
In terms of sugar control, Organic fruit & grain bars takes the lead with only 40.54g of sugar per 100g, whereas Semi-Sweet Chocolate Chips contains 46.67g. Lower sugar content is often linked to better metabolic health.
